Upgrading a NodeB to an eNodeB means upgrading a 3G network to a 4G network.
First, you need to make sure that your device supports LTE. Whether the RF unit and universal main control and transmission unit of the base station support LTE. If the device does not support the upgrade, you need to replace the device. Otherwise, the upgrade cannot be performed.
After the device is ready, you need to prepare the version and data required for the upgrade.
Start the operation after all preparations are complete:
1. Remotely delete the old configuration data on the U2000. Be sure to back up before deleting it to prevent accidents.
2. Import the prepared new configuration data to the base station through the U2000.
3. After the data is imported successfully, wait for a period of time. If no alarm is generated on the device and services are running properly, The upgrade is successful.
During the upgrade from a 3G base station to a 4G base station, services will be interrupted and the operation is complex. Therefore, you are advised not to perform this operation lightly. Please seek support from your local representative office.
